Desjardins says Henrik Sedin out until after all-star break with upper-body injury

NEWARK, N.J. – Vancouver Canucks coach Willie Desjardins says captain Henrik Sedin will be out until after the all-star break with an upper-body injury.

Sedin was hurt in the first period of Vancouver’s 2-1 shootout win at the Islanders on Sunday when he was checked into the boards away from the play by New York’s Mikhail Grabovski.

Grabovski got a five-minute penalty for boarding and a game misconduct on the play.

The Canucks are half way through a six-game road trip that continues Tuesday against the New York Rangers.

“Henrik won’t have any more games on this trip,” Desjardins said after the Canucks’ practice on Monday. “Hopefully he’ll be ready after the all-star break.”

Sedin leads the Canucks with 28 assists this season, and is second on the team with 37 points behind twin brother Daniel’s 41.
